84057 Zip Code Historical Education Level Data
ACS 2010-2014 data
Total population: 37,964
84057 Zip Code | Utah | U.S. | |
Total 25 Years and Over Population | 19,879, 100% | 1,642,728 | 209,056,129 |
Less Than High School | 2,274, 11.44%, see rank | 8.98% | 13.67% |
High School Graduate | 3,915, 19.69%, see rank | 23.27% | 27.95% |
Some College or Associate Degree | 7,470, 37.58%, see rank | 37.10% | 29.09% |
Bachelor Degree | 4,619, 23.24%, see rank | 20.48% | 18.27% |
Master, Doctorate, or Professional Degree | 1,601, 8.05%, see rank | 10.17% | 11.01% |
USA.com Education Index# | 13.79, see rank | 13.91 | 13.54 |
# Higher USA.com Education Index means more educated population.
